SBH Maintenance Engineer - Stonebreaker Hotel (Markham Hill)

Hay Creek Hotels is seeking a Maintenance Engineer / Facilities Supervisor to maintain their new property, the Stonebreaker Hotel. The role involves managing guest issues, ensuring operational upkeep of the hotel facilities, and leading the maintenance staff while adhering to safety and compliance regulations.

HotelManagement ConsultingResortsRestaurants

Responsibilities

Manage customer needs by responding promptly to all guest issues, maintain a responsive complaint program and address all work orders in an efficient and effective manner
Responsible for the proper operations and upkeep of all; electrical, mechanical, plumbing, HVAC, painting, tile work, laundry, kitchen, refrigeration, lighting systems, and all specialized equipment
Ensure compliance with city, state and /or federal code ordnances and maintain all required permits and licenses for entire facility
Cost effective management of equipment purchases or leasing, service contracts, repair and maintenance agreements, out-sourcing local 3rd party tradesmen, management and achievement of budgeted capital and repair and maintenance operating costs
Responsible for management of engineering/maintenance staff including; scheduling, employee relations, effective communication venues, coaching, evaluating and reviewing, hiring & training, and leading the team through delegation and accountability
Maintain department expenses within budget. Evaluate third party bids, code invoices, mange direct accounts, and ensure monthly checkbook accounting is complete and accurate
Develop & maintain preventive maintenance programs for all equipment, guest rooms, restaurant, public areas, parking garage and all other facilities located on property
Leadership role in curb appeal, landscaping, and grounds maintenance in all weather conditions
Manage the hotels safety, security and health programs with local fire department, other emergency respondents and vendors to educate staff in areas related to; Energy conservation, Security protection, Safety awareness, loss prevention, safety manual, OSHA regulations, Right to Understand Law, safety committee, emergency processes and fire alarm procedures
Adheres to all; health, sanitation, safety and security, laws, policies and procedures in the department/hotel
Monitors and ensures departmental compliance with all state and federal wage and hour employment laws
